Who is GMB glasmanufaktur Brandenburg?
Borosil Renewables has announced that its German subsidiary, GMB Glasmanufaktur Brandenburg GmbH, has filed for insolvency under German Insolvency Code (InsO) before the jurisdictional court at Cottbus.
Is GMB a good choice for European solar panels?
GMB, with a capacity of 350 tonnes per day (TPD), had served European manufacturers of solar modules for their requirements of solar glass. However, demand erosion became drastic last year, as Chinese manufacturers flooded the European market with severely underpriced solar modules.
How big is India's solar glass industry?
India's solar module manufacturing capacity has already crossed 90 gigawatts and is expected to reach 150 gigawatts by March 2027, creating massive potential for domestic solar glass makers. Borosil aims to double down on its solar glass innovation, manufacturing scale, and ESG-aligned clean energy strategy.
Will a five-year anti-dumping duty affect solar glass imports in India?
The recent imposition of a five-year anti-dumping duty on solar glass imports from China and Vietnam, effective December 4, 2024, has created a more level playing field for Indian producers.
In 2025, the typical cost of commercial lithium battery energy storage systems, including the battery, battery management system (BMS), inverter (PCS), and installation, ranges from $280 to $580 per kWh. Larger systems (100 kWh or more) can cost between $180 to $300 per kWh. . In 2025, average turnkey container prices range around USD 200 to USD 400 per kWh depending on capacity, components, and location of deployment.
